PRINCIPAL CAD ENGINEER
Contribute to the strategic direction of the business and support impactful mission outcomes as a Principal CAD Engineer at GDIT. Here, you'll enable the success of the most critical government missions and the growth of a meaningful career in Construction and Support.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ES & DUTIES
• Create 3D models and detail 2D production drawings of mechanical, electrical and structural naval systems. Proficiency in Autodesk Inventor and AutoCAD is preferred.
• Familiar with military specifications (MIL-SPECS) and NAVSEA standards to develop technical data packages.
• Collaborate with customers, engineers and production personnel to optimize design and support production.
• Conduct feasibility studies and risk assessments to prevent possible design problems.
• Prepare for and participate in customer meetings and design reviews.
• Manage the impact of design changes across models, drawings and bills of materials (BOM) to maintain configuration control.
• Conduct ship checks on Navy vessels to gather data and verify existing configurations. Ability to access confined spaces and climb ladders.
• Mentor junior designers and drafters, review their work and ensure drawing standards are met.
WHAT YOU'LL NEED TO SUCCEED
Bring your initiative and drive for innovation to GDIT. The Principal CAD Engineer must have:
• Education: Bachelors of Science or equivalent
• Experience: 15+ years of related experience
• Security clearance level: Secret
• US citizenship required
